Table 3 Basic comparison of the algorithms

  Advantages Disadvantages
Random scheduling The best scheduling flexibility Cannot provide fairness especially for edge UEs
Algorithm 1 Maximizes SIR at the edge UEs; good scheduling flexibility. No enhancement for non-edge outer users’ SIR
Algorithm 2 Maximizes SIR at the edge UEs; additionally protects non-edge outer users more than algorithm 1; increases overall SIR A small loss in scheduling flexibility
Proportional fair Increases SIR at the edge UEs compared to random scheduling Cannot provide the best SIR for edge UEs while balancing fairness between all UEs